概覽 key value 項目名稱 node微信公眾號開發 項目描述 使用node編寫接口,前后端分離獲取簽名數據 開發者 leinov ...
因為使用了Bot Framework開發了一個小功能,它目前支持了Skype Teams Slack等,但在國內來講,微信還是一個比較流行的軟件,所以需要接上微信 原來開發Bot的時候使用的是.Net開發的,這次我決定使用Nodejs開發一個簡單的后台程序。 說真的,剛開始的時候沒有任何經驗,剛開始的時候,還是很辛苦的。 一.注冊一個微信公眾號 我開始的時候注冊了一個個人訂閱帳號,才發現似乎接口不 ...
2017-02-16 14:05 1 5607 推薦指數:
概覽 key value 項目名稱 node微信公眾號開發 項目描述 使用node編寫接口,前后端分離獲取簽名數據 開發者 leinov ...
准備工作 1.首先注冊自己的微信公眾號。 微信公眾號現在分為訂閱號,服務號,企業號,服務號和企業號不對個人開發者開放,所以我們只能選擇訂閱號。 但是訂閱號也有認證和未認證之分,認證的訂閱號支持的接口更多也更高級,下圖是微信的接口權限圖,只截取了一部分。 如果我們想測試這些接口 ...
微信公眾號有個規則,一旦開啟了開發者模式,其他的常規功能就都必須通過接口調用完成。比如說自定義菜單功能,必須通過發送post請求的方式生成。本章就通過關注到取消關注的整個過程來談一談nodejs是怎么樣與微信交互的。這些功能的入口就是你在測試公眾號里面填寫的URL(以下用/login/wechat ...
微信的網頁授權指的是在微信公眾號中訪問第三方網頁時獲取用戶地理、個人等信息的權限。對於開發了自己的網頁app應用時,獲取個人的信息非常重要。上篇博客講到了注冊時可以獲取用戶的信息,很多人會問為什么還需要網頁授權這種方式去獲取呢,直接從數據庫中讀取不就可以了嗎?這樣的做的原因是服務器會話時間終究是 ...
前言 大概是一個月前,自己用業余時間做了一個微信公眾號。微信開發,尤其是對后台不熟悉的人來說顯得尤其困難。首先要克服的是后台語言(nodejs)的一些不熟悉困難,其次,也是最大的一點困難是在跟微信交互過程。借助各種工具和幾位朋友的幫助,總算把各種困難解決,並且在自己計划的時間內建立起來公眾號 ...
由於鹵煮本人是做前端開發的,所以在做公眾號過程中基本上沒有遇到前端問題,在這方面花的時間是最少的。加上用了mui框架(純css界面)和自己積累的代碼,很快地開發出了界面來。接着是后台開發。鹵煮選的是nodejs,作為中小型的項目開發,nodejs是前端開發人員的首選。然后是選了一些開發包,幫助快速 ...
在測試環境下開發完成代表着你離正式上線的目標不遠了。接下來本章就主要談一談把測試環境的公眾號升級為正式的公眾號。 服務器和域名 目前為止我們只是在自己的電腦上完成了測試環境。真實的線上環境當然需要自己購買服務器和域名了。鹵煮買的是阿里雲的ecs雲服務器,配置是單核1G內存,硬盤是40g。對於鹵 ...
ps:注冊微信測試公眾號 01 獲取access_token access_token是公眾號的全局唯一票據,公眾號調用各接口時都需使用access_token。開發者需要進行妥善保存。access_token的存儲至少要保留512個字符空間。access_token的有效期目前為2個小時,需 ...